56 Days is a murder mystery that takes place during the beginning of the pandemic. I found it kinda hard to rate because what was good was very good but the first half of the book was very dull. It felt like at times Catherine would use big unnecessary words and provide too much details for things that really didn’t need it. What really made the stories my was the plot twists; not only that but the plot twists within the plot twists. From what the characters were to the relationships they had with each other. Even the characters that weren’t alive had a mystery to them (who they were as people and their relationship with the main characters). Overall I rate this book a 3.75/5 stars. What was good was really good but it took a while to get good and it’s flaws ere apparent. It was fairly quotable and the last third of it had me itching to continue reading. I feel like the ending could have been a bit more detailed but overall a good mystery worth the read.
